调整订单计息开始时间

This commit is contained in:
luofei 2023-07-14 16:25:40 +08:00
parent b860a068f7
commit d77397e21c
2 changed files with 2 additions and 1 deletions

View File

@ -732,7 +732,7 @@ class StoreOrderRepository extends BaseRepository
app()->make(MerchantRepository::class)->computedLockMoney($order);
}
if (!empty($order->interest) && $order->interest->status == StoreOrderInterest::STATUS_UNSETTLED) {
$order->interest->start_time = date('Y-m-d H:i:s', strtotime("+{$order['merchant']['settle_cycle']} days"));
$order->interest->start_time = date('Y-m-d H:i:s', strtotime("+{$order->interest->settle_cycle} days"));
$order->interest->save();
}
$order->save();

View File

@ -31,6 +31,7 @@ class OrderCreate
'to_mer_id' => $order['mer_id'] ?? 0,
'total_price' => $groupOrder['total_price'],
'rate' => $order['merchant']['interest_rate'] ?? 0,
'settle_cycle' => $order['merchant']['settle_cycle'] ?? 0,
];
return $storeOrderInterestRepository->create($data);
}